NASCAR Files Counterclaim Against 23XI, Front Row and Polk

23XI Front Row Motorsports NASCAR

In an article by Kelly Crandall on RACER.COM, NASCAR filed a counterclaim Wednesday against 23XI Racing, Front Row Motorsports and 23XI Racing co-owner Curtis Polk, alleging violations of the Sherman Act and conspiracy.

“Beginning no later than June 2022, Counterclaim Defendants engaged in a conspiracy and agreement in unreasonable restraint of interstate trade and commerce, constituting a violation of Section 1 of the Sherman Act,” the claim states. “Curtis Polk knowingly and actively orchestrated and participated in this illegal conspiracy, while working as a member of the (Team Negotiating Committee) on behalf of the RTA and aiding 23XI’s and Front Row’s participation in the scheme, also continuing a violation of Section 1 of the Sherman Act.”

In claiming conspiracy, NASCAR says 23XI and Front Row tried to get others to pressure NASCAR to accept the terms they wanted. Those efforts were done through the media, interfering with NASCAR’s broadcast agreement negotiations, threatening to boycott events and engaging in a group boycott of a team owner council meeting.
